A small inland sea between the Bosphorus and the Dardanelles. It is connected to the Black Sea by the Bosphorus and the Aegean Sea by the Dardanelles, and separates the Asian and European sides of Turkey. In ancient times it was called the Propontis Sea. It is 280 km long from east to west, and 80 km wide at its widest point from north to south. It has an area of only 11,350 km2, but its average depth is 494 m, and in the center it is 1,355 m deep. It has an average salinity of 22‰ and no strong currents. It was formed by crustal movements from the end of the Neogene to the early Pleistocene of the Quaternary period, and is an area prone to earthquakes. There are two island groups, and the Kizil Islands near Istanbul are mainly a tourist destination. The other is the Marmara Islands, located near the Kapdau Peninsula on the southern coast. They are made up of granite, slate and marble, and since there were marble quarries there since ancient times, the Sea of Marmara is named after the Greek word marmaros, meaning marble.
